What Does Business Class from Austin to Nha Trang Cost?

Business class from Austin to Nha Trang is one of the more rewarding long-haul routes in the Southeast Asia corridor, and CEOFLIGHTS clients regularly secure round-trip fares between $2,753 and $7,598 — a range that reflects both seasonal variation and access to private fares unavailable on public booking platforms.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) connects through major Asian hubs to Cam Ranh International Airport (CXR), the gateway to Vietnam's coastal resort city of Nha Trang, across an average total journey time of approximately 18.9 hours.

Four major international carriers serve this corridor with business class products: Singapore Airlines, Thai Airways, Cathay Pacific, and Emirates. Each routes through a different connecting hub — Singapore Changi, Bangkok Suvarnabhumi, Hong Kong International, and Dubai International respectively — giving travelers meaningful choice in how they structure their journey. The hub you transit through can significantly affect both total travel time and the on-ground experience between flights.

When Is the Cheapest Time to Fly Business Class to Nha Trang?

How much does business class from Austin to Nha Trang cost? Round-trip fares in business class typically range from $2,753 on the lower end during value months to $7,598 at peak premium pricing. The widest spread tends to occur when corporate demand spikes in spring and summer. Travelers who book through a travel agency with access to consolidated and negotiated fares — rather than booking directly or through consumer sites — frequently land toward the lower end of that range.

The best months to book business class on this route are January, February, March, November, and December.

These months align with lower corporate travel demand on trans-Pacific and Southeast Asian routes, and carriers are more likely to release discounted inventory during these windows. January and February in particular offer strong value while also coinciding with pleasant weather conditions along Vietnam's south-central coast, where Nha Trang sits.

Travelers planning this route should consider building at least one night into their hub layover, particularly when routing through Singapore or Hong Kong, where airport hotel options and transit visa arrangements are well-established. A 18.9-hour average journey time means that how you structure the connection has a direct impact on how you arrive in Nha Trang. 02How long is the flight from Austin to Nha Trang in business class?

The total travel time from Austin to Nha Trang averages around 18.9 hours, including a connection, as there are no nonstop flights on this route. Most itineraries route through hub cities such as Singapore, Dubai, Hong Kong, or Bangkok.

03What are the best airlines for business class from Austin to Nha Trang?

Singapore Airlines, Thai Airways, Cathay Pacific, and Emirates are among the top-rated options for business class on this route, each offering lie-flat seats and premium dining on long-haul segments. The best choice depends on your preferred layover city and loyalty program.
